Publisher Top Hat Studios and development studio Suzaku have announced Sense – A Cyberpunk Ghost Story. Which to launch for Linux, Mac and Windows PC’s in 2018.
Sense – A Cyberpunk Ghost Story is a 2.5D game. While taking inspiration from Clock Tower and Fatal Frame. Set in the year 2083 in Neo Hong-Kong the story follows Mei-Lin Mak. Hence a young woman with cybernetic eyes pulled into the maelstrom of an unsolved supernatural mystery. All just from centuries past.
So she peers deeper into the mystery. Her perception of reality slowly crumbles around her. Leaving her to question every intricacy of her surroundings.
Under the neon lights of a cyperpunk dystopia. The ruins of the Chung Sing building hide a bloody mystery illuminated. While this is by both the traditions of Chinese folklore. As well as the innovations of the industrial future. If there is any hope of escaping this nightmare. Mei-Lin must explore this complex. As she also pieces together the stories of 14 lost souls. Discovering the truth of her own family curse. With careful attention to pacing, atmosphere and storytelling.
Sense – A Cyberpunk Ghost Story Mission:
Also, Sense – A Cyberpunk Ghost Story announced that it will return the horror genre to its roots. Celebrating the slow, fearful creep of dread. Instead of turning to action and jump scares. Mei finds herself in the role of an agent. A programmer and not a soldier. The ghosts – the glitches of the universe – are spirits and not zombies. So the games scares are from within, not from the horrors around.
A Kickstarter crowdfunding campaign is planned for later this year. Helping to accelerate the development process. Also to potentially provide necessary funding to make PlayStation 4 and PlayStation VITA releases possible. A public demo release is also planned for later this month.
